Domiciliary Care

By offering care at home for adults living in the Tandridge area we enable clients to continue to live safely, comfortably and as independently as possible in their own homes. Our staff are kind and caring and develop positive relationships with our customers, always treating them with respect and maintaining their privacy and dignity at all times.

We provide high-quality care and support with a complete range of services, including personal care, household assistance, and support.

Our experienced and highly trained Care Options carers complement our sister company, Cherry Lodge Rest Home to provide a complete care package, residential and domiciliary, for people over 65, in and around the Tandridge district of Surrey (including Caterham, Whyteleafe, Warlingham, Woldingham).

Care Options was established by Mrs Cherie Callender, the agency’s Registered Manager, in 1998. It is a domiciliary care agency supporting around 60-70 older people, some with dementia, who live at home and are cared for by our team of friendly staff.

The agency offers temporary or regular assistance depending on the needs of the individual.

Care is provided by regular staff who understand clients’ needs and preferences. Staff are kind and caring and have positive relationships with the people they support. Clients are encouraged and supported to maintain their independence. The staff treat people with respect and maintain their privacy and dignity when providing their care.

Staff all receive induction and ongoing training. The induction process includes shadowing experienced staff to understand people’s needs and preferences. Staff are well-supported by the management team. Staff meet with their line managers regularly to discuss their performance and training needs.

People’s needs are assessed before they first use the service. They are involved in their assessments and the planning of their care. Care plans are reviewed regularly to ensure they continue to accurately reflect people’s needs. We monitor clients’ health and report any concerns promptly. Care Options communicates effectively with other professionals, ensuring that people’s healthcare needs were met. We ensure that we understand people’s dietary needs and prepare their food in the way they prefer. We encourage people who are reluctant to eat to maintain adequate nutrition.

We plan care to meet individual needs. People are supported to have maximum choice and control of their lives. We support people in the least restrictive way possible and their best interests; our policies and systems support this practice. We ask for and record people’s consent to care every step of the way. We provide reliable, well-planned care. People are always able to contact us when they need to and access any information they require. Staff time-keeping is important to us and we will be sure to inform people of any unavoidable changes. Spot checks are carried out to ensure staff provide people’s care safely and in the way they prefer. We contact people regularly to seek their views and act upon their feedback. Any complaints received are managed in line with our written complaints procedure. Complaints are investigated by the registered manager and action is taken to address any issues raised.
